Auto merge of #87476 - pietroalbini:stable-next, r=Mark-Simulacrum 1.54.0
Prepare 1.54.0 release This PR builds the stable artifacts for the 1.54.0 release. Backports included: * https://github.com/rust-lang/rust/pull/86696 * #87167 * #87210 I was *not* able to cherry-pick https://github.com/rust-lang/rust/pull/87390 as that didn't apply cleanly to the stable branch. `@GuillaumeGomez` `@notriddle` could it be possible to get a PR targeting `stable` backporting that fix? Also, this **enables** incremental compilation on the stable channel. r? `@Mark-Simulacrum` cc `@rust-lang/release`
